Sparse tensor product finite elements for two scale elliptic and parabolic equations with discontinuous coefficients
The paper develops the essentially optimal sparse tensor product finite element method for solving two scale elliptic and parabolic problems in a domain D⊂Rd, d=2,3, which is embedded with a periodic array of inclusions of microscopic sizes and spacing.
